The East Chatham branch of the United States Post Office honored the new postage stamps “Animal Rescue-Adopt a Shelter Pet Stamp” by hosting a food and supply drive for the Columbia-Greene Humane Society/SPCA. The Post Office collected hundreds of dollars in food and supplies for the homeless animals at the Shelter.
